Image Source: economicshelp.org Disequilibrium WebWhen supply and demand move in the same direction, price is indeterminate. That is because an increase in supply decrease price while an increase in demand will increase price. Since the price axis moves in both directions, the net effect is based on which shift is stronger. Since that cannot be known, the price will be indeterminate. scan canon ts3320 https://ltmusicmgmt.com

WebWhen supply decreases, it creates an excess demand at the old equilibrium price. This results in a competition among buyers, which raises the price of product or services. Increase in price results in a rise in supply and fall in demand. These changes will continue until the new equilibrium is established.
